57 changes: 41 additions & 16 deletions src/bluetooth-fw/nimble/gatt_client_discovery.c
Original file line number Diff line number Diff line change
Expand Up @@ -46,6 +46,17 @@ typedef struct {
ListNode *current_characteristic;
} GATTServiceDiscoveryContext;

// Sets s_discovery_in_progress to false and gives the stop semaphore if a stop has been
// requested. Called from every callback termination path so that bt_driver_gatt_stop_discovery
// is always unblocked, even when discovery completes (naturally or via error) after the stop
// request flag was set but before the next stop-check at the top of a callback runs.
static void prv_signal_discovery_done(void) {
s_discovery_in_progress = false;
if (s_stop_discovery_requested) {
xSemaphoreGive(s_discovery_stopped);
}
}

Expand All @@ -543,14 +551,19 @@ BTErrno bt_driver_gatt_start_discovery_range(const GAPLEConnection *connection,
context->connection = (GAPLEConnection *)connection;
context->range = *data;

// Reset stop flag and mark discovery in progress BEFORE issuing the discovery so that
// callbacks (which run on the NimBLE host task) cannot observe stale flags from a prior
// stop request and silently abort the freshly-started discovery.
s_stop_discovery_requested = false;
s_discovery_in_progress = true;

int rc = ble_gattc_disc_all_svcs(conn_handle, prv_find_inc_svc_cb, (void *)context);
if (rc != 0) {
s_discovery_in_progress = false;
kernel_free(context);
return BTErrnoInternalErrorBegin + rc;
}

s_discovery_in_progress = true;
s_stop_discovery_requested = false;

return BTErrnoOK;
}

Expand All @@ -563,10 +576,22 @@ BTErrno bt_driver_gatt_stop_discovery(GAPLEConnection *connection) {
return BTErrnoInvalidState;
}

// Drain any stale semaphore signal that might have been left by a previous race
// (e.g. a callback gave the semaphore but we observed in_progress=false and skipped
// the take). This guarantees the take below waits for a fresh give.
xSemaphoreTake(s_discovery_stopped, 0);

// Set the stop request BEFORE checking in_progress. A callback that runs after this
// point will observe the flag (either at its top check or via prv_signal_discovery_done
// at its termination path) and give the semaphore. Without this ordering, a callback
// that completed naturally between our check and our flag set would never give the
// semaphore, causing xSemaphoreTake below to block forever and hang KernelBG until
// the watchdog resets the watch into PRF.
s_stop_discovery_requested = true;
if (s_discovery_in_progress) {
s_stop_discovery_requested = true;
xSemaphoreTake(s_discovery_stopped, portMAX_DELAY);
}
s_stop_discovery_requested = false;

return BTErrnoOK;
}
